You might check out the Dendra Deer Hunter. 3.75" blade, flipper, thumb studs, pocket clip and micarta scales. Micarta isn't exactly rubbery, but it is quite grippy and usually gets even grippier when wet. It also tends to feel warmer and more organic than G10. Just be aware that the Deer Hunter is both thick and heavy.
